Subject: Key rotation — Marlinport partner SFTP drop

Heads up for on-call: the credential backing the Marlinport partner SFTP drop rotates tonight at 02:00. The ingest poller in Cravenhall will briefly retry; no action needed unless failures persist past 02:30. If you must restart the poller manually, use the new key for the internal relay, shown below.

service key, fawip-bajef: kto11_Qt5wZK9vdNC

## v0.9.3 — Lanternmill Metrics Sidecar

For this week's eng sync: the sidecar now batches counter flushes every 10s instead of per-request, cutting aggregator load by roughly 40% in the Dornvale cluster. Histogram bucket boundaries were widened to reduce cardinality, and a guard was added against duplicate emission during pod restarts. Canary runs through Friday. The owner accountable for the rollout is named below.

account owner for fajep-yagef: Kasix Eliiel

14:22 — Autocomplete widget on Quillmark checkout starts returning empty suggestion lists. Turns out the Fenwick geocoder rolled a schema change and our parser silently dropped every result. Nobody noticed for 40 minutes because the widget fails quiet (thanks, past us). Marta shipped a hotfix parser with a loud error path. Suggestions recovered by 15:03. The offending deploy is traceable via the token below.

trace token, fafog-kageg: htk4_98e6

- [ ] Step 7: Archive cold storage buckets (Glacierline tier). Confirm both ceremony witnesses are present, verify bucket manifests match the Oxbow ledger, then seal the archive key shares. Plugin authors may observe but not handle shares. Once sealed, the archive index itself is encrypted and can only be reopened with the passphrase below.

vault phrase of badup-hahig = tamael-aldael-kelmir-istael-fenok-istwyn-tamius-jorath-oliion

## Inkpress Environments (PDF Invoice Renderer)

Hey — quick map of Inkpress for your review. We render customer invoices to PDF in three environments: sandbox, staging, and prod. Sandbox uses synthetic invoice data only, so poke at it freely. Staging pulls scrubbed copies of real invoices, and prod is locked down to the billing service account. Font fetching and template sandboxing are the spicy bits security-wise. Staging currently runs with these settings.

deployment values, kajep-kageg:
[praix]
host = praix.paliqcorp.corp
user = praix_svc
database = praix_prod